6.2 Filter Maintenance and Replacement

Regular filter maintenance is essential for optimal water quality and system performance. Clean the filter cartridges weekly by rinsing with a garden hose and soaking in a filter cleaner every 1-2 months. Replace worn-out filters every 1-2 years to ensure efficiency. Refer to your owner’s manual for specific instructions tailored to your Hot Springs spa model. Proper upkeep extends the life of your spa and maintains clean, safe water for enjoyment.

7.3 Water Quality and Chemical Balance

Maintaining proper water quality and chemical balance is essential for a safe and enjoyable spa experience. Regularly test and adjust pH, alkalinity, and sanitizer levels to prevent imbalances. Imbalanced water can cause eye irritation, skin discomfort, or equipment damage. Use test strips for quick checks and follow the owner’s manual guidelines. Avoid over-chlorination, as it may lead to strong odors or skin irritation. If issues persist, consult your manual or contact an authorized dealership for assistance.

11.2 Tips for Reducing Energy Consumption

To minimize energy use, maintain a moderate temperature when the spa is not in use. Regularly inspect and replace worn-out covers to retain heat. Adjust filtration cycles to run only during off-peak hours. Consider upgrading to energy-efficient pumps and heaters. Perform routine maintenance to ensure optimal performance. Utilize the Freshwater Smart Monitoring System to track and optimize energy usage. Schedule specific times for heating to avoid unnecessary consumption. Properly sizing your spa for your needs also helps reduce overall energy expenditure.
